PROTECTIVE EFFECT OF LORANTHUS LONGIFLORUS ON LEARNING AND MEMORY OF RATS EXPOSED TO ELECTROMAGNETIC RADIATION (EMR)  

Journal Title: International Research Journal of Pharmacy (IRJP) - Year 2013, Vol 4, Issue 5

Abstract

The interaction of mobile phone radio-frequency electromagnetic radiation (RF-EMR) with the brain is a serious concern of our society. In this study, we aimed to experiment on the antioxidative property of a parasitic plant Loranthus longiflorus (Loranthaceae) to protect central nervous system against oxidative damages of mobile phone electromagnetic radiation (EMR). Healthy male albino wistar rats were exposed to RF-EMR by giving 5 min calling/ 5min interval for 1 hour per day for two month, Keeping a GSM (0.9 GHz/1.8 GHz) mobile phone in Silent mode (no ring tone) in the cage. After 15, 30, 45, 60 days exposure, three randomly picked animals from both groups were tested with using Morris water maze. Antioxidant compounds and their Neuroprotective action of Loranthus longiflorus bark sample collected from Ficus religiosa host trees were assessed. Rats which have been feed with Ethyl acetate Extract of Loranthus longiflorus (EAL) bark (700mg/kg body weight, p.o.)
